计算机网络安全与信息技术是现代信息社会的重要组成部分,它们共同保障了网络空间的稳定和安全。在探讨这一主题时,我们可以从多个角度进行分析。
一、网络安全的基本概念
1. 定义:网络安全是指保护计算机网络及其相关系统免受各种威胁,包括恶意软件、病毒、黑客攻击等,确保网络数据的安全传输和完整性。
2. 重要性:随着互联网技术的飞速发展,网络安全的重要性日益凸显。它不仅关系到个人隐私和信息安全,还涉及到国家安全、社会稳定等多个层面。
3. 技术发展:网络安全技术不断进步,从早期的防火墙、入侵检测系统(IDS)发展到现在的加密技术、区块链、人工智能等,为网络安全提供了更为强大的保障。
二、常见的网络安全威胁
1. 恶意软件:包括病毒、蠕虫、木马等,这些软件通常会破坏或窃取用户的个人信息和财产。
2. 网络钓鱼:通过伪造电子邮件或网站诱导用户输入敏感信息,如用户名和密码。
3. 拒绝服务攻击:通过大量发送请求导致目标服务器资源耗尽,从而无法正常提供服务。
4. 零日攻击:针对尚未公开的漏洞进行攻击,由于其隐蔽性和突发性,难以防范。
5. 社交工程:利用人际关系进行欺骗,获取用户信任后窃取信息。
6. 内部威胁:员工或合作伙伴的恶意行为,如泄露机密信息或执行未经授权的操作。
7. 物理攻击:通过物理手段对计算机硬件设备进行破坏,如雷击、水灾等。
8. 供应链攻击:攻击者通过渗透供应商或合作伙伴的网络,间接影响整个供应链的安全性。
三、防御措施
1. 加密技术:使用加密算法对数据进行加密,确保数据在传输和存储过程中的安全性。
2. 防火墙和入侵检测系统:通过设置防火墙和安装入侵检测系统来阻止未授权访问和检测潜在的攻击行为。
3. 定期更新和补丁管理:及时更新操作系统和应用软件的补丁,修复已知的安全漏洞。
4. 安全意识培训:提高员工的安全意识,教育他们识别和防范各种网络威胁。
5. 多因素认证:采用多因素认证方法,如密码加手机验证码或生物特征验证,增加账户的安全性。
6. 数据备份和恢复:定期备份关键数据,并确保在发生灾难时能够迅速恢复。
7. 隔离和沙箱技术:将高风险操作置于隔离环境中运行,避免对主系统造成潜在威胁。
8. 安全审计和监控:定期进行安全审计,检查系统中的潜在风险点,并实施实时监控以及时发现异常行为。
四、未来展望
1. 人工智能与机器学习:AI技术将在网络安全领域发挥重要作用,通过智能分析和预测来提前识别潜在的安全威胁。
2. 区块链技术:利用区块链的去中心化特性,可以提高数据的安全性和透明度。
3. 量子计算:虽然目前尚处于研究阶段,但量子计算有潜力解决传统加密算法面临的挑战,为网络安全带来新的可能性。
4. 物联网安全:随着物联网设备的普及,如何确保这些设备的安全性成为亟待解决的问题。
5. 云计算安全:云服务的发展带来了便利,但也带来了新的安全挑战,需要制定相应的安全策略来应对。
6. 国际合作与标准制定:网络安全是一个全球性的问题,需要各国加强合作,共同制定国际标准来应对跨国网络威胁。
综上所述,计算机网络安全与信息技术是现代社会不可或缺的重要组成部分。随着技术的发展,我们将面临更多未知的挑战,但同时也拥有更多的机会来提升我们的安全防护能力。只有通过不断的技术创新和政策引导,我们才能构建一个更加安全、稳定的网络环境,为社会的可持续发展提供坚实的保障。